技术文摘
基于 K8s 技术打造通用区块链方案
基于 K8s 技术打造通用区块链方案
在当今数字化时代,区块链技术凭借其去中心化、不可篡改、安全可靠等特性,正逐渐改变着众多行业的运作方式。而 Kubernetes(简称 K8s)作为一种强大的容器编排工具,为构建高效、可扩展的区块链解决方案提供了坚实的基础。
K8s 技术为区块链部署带来了诸多优势。它能够实现自动化的部署和管理,大大提高了区块链节点的上线速度和运维效率。通过定义资源配置和部署策略,K8s 可以确保区块链节点在不同的环境中保持一致的运行状态。
K8s 具备出色的弹性扩展能力。随着业务的增长,区块链网络的处理能力需求可能会不断增加。利用 K8s 的自动扩缩容机制,可以根据实际负载动态调整节点数量,从而保证区块链系统始终能够高效处理交易。
K8s 提供了高可用性保障。它可以监控节点的健康状况,并在出现故障时自动进行故障转移和恢复,确保区块链服务的连续性。
在基于 K8s 技术打造通用区块链方案时,需要从多个方面进行考虑。首先是网络架构的设计,要确保节点之间的通信稳定且高效。其次是数据存储的优化,以满足区块链数据的快速读写和持久化需求。
在智能合约的部署方面,借助 K8s 的容器化特性,可以实现快速、可靠的部署和更新。要注重安全机制的整合,包括身份验证、访问控制和加密技术等,保障区块链系统的安全性。
为了实现良好的用户体验,还需要构建直观易用的管理界面,方便管理员对区块链网络进行监控和管理。
将 K8s 技术应用于区块链领域,能够充分发挥两者的优势,打造出高效、可扩展、稳定可靠的通用区块链方案。这不仅有助于推动区块链技术在更广泛的领域落地应用,也为企业和开发者提供了更强大的工具和平台,以应对日益复杂的业务需求和技术挑战。随着技术的不断发展和创新,相信基于 K8s 的区块链解决方案将在未来发挥更加重要的作用,为数字经济的发展注入新的活力。
- Win11 Dev 预览版 25188 发布:设 Windows Terminal 为系统默认终端
- Windows11 更改图标图案的方法及我的电脑图标样式修改技巧
- 如何将新安装的 Centos 7 系统网卡名称改为 eth0
- CentOS 双网卡下更改网卡编号与配置静态路由的办法
- Win11 天气小部件的变化:位置准确性提升
- CentOS 中 yum 软件包管理器基本使用指南
- Win11 Beta 预览版 22621.586 与 22622.586(KB5016701)已发布(含更新内容汇总)
- CentOS 中 Pureftp 配置文件常用配置项汇总
- CentOS 系统中 OpenVZ 虚拟机的安装与基本运用
- 六步轻松在树莓派上安装 Win11
- CentOS 系统信息查看与防火墙配置方法
- CentOS 系统下 rpm 包管理器的使用窍门
- CentOS 系统中 quota 安装以管理磁盘配额
- Win11 无法识别 Xbox 控制器的应对之策
- CentOS7 中 hostnamectl 命令的详细使用